Laptop doesn't start until it heats up

Hi all,

I've got a Studio 1555, 4GB, 320GB, Core 2 Duo. For last couple of months, I have been facing a very strange issue with my laptop. When I switch my power button, the button shows the light. I hear the sound of the system being working but nothing is displayed.

After that, when I keep my system on bed and cover it with some cloth or something, it gets heated up in 15-20 minutes. After that when I again push the power button, then the cooling fan starts working and the system works normally afterwards.

I have tried switching the display but it doesn't work anywhere. I took it to the repair guy but he doesn't understand the issue.

If you have not yet done so, unplug the system, remove the battery and hold the power button for 30 sec.  Remove and reinstall both memory modules and the hard drive.

If that doesn't solve the problem, it is likely you have a bad cold solder joint somewhere on the mainboard - the system board will need replacement to solve the problem.
